SECTION/RULE §356.504 - Security Policies and Procedures
Chapter Review Date 06/21/2024

Centers and satellite shelters must develop, maintain, and comply with written policies and procedures to promote the safety and security of residents, nonresidents, employees, and volunteers. These policies and procedures must address:(1) intruders on the property, such as a batterer;(2) assaults;(3) bomb threats;(4) threatening telephone calls;(5) power outages;(6) evacuations;(7) natural disasters (e.g., hurricanes, tornadoes, floods, fires); and(8) technology safety and data security.
